India recently expressed its concerns regarding a defense gathering in China, where member nations were unable to reach a consensus on a joint statement. This gathering was significant as it brought together various countries to discuss critical defense and security issues affecting the region. However, the lack of agreement on a joint statement has raised eyebrows and sparked discussions among international observers.

The meeting was aimed at fostering cooperation and addressing common security challenges, but the inability to produce a unified statement highlights the complexities and differing priorities among the participating nations. India, which has been vocal about its stance on regional security, emphasized the need for collaborative efforts to enhance stability and peace.

Analysts suggest that the failure to adopt a joint statement may reflect underlying tensions and divergent views on pressing security matters.
